MY STORY

From an early age, I had a dream of building and designing beautiful homes.  Growing up in both Poland and Greece gave me a unique experience and allowed me to see a variety of different styles.  As I grew, my love of design increased and became the focus of my formal education.  After being accepted to both architecture and art programs, I chose to attend Ryerson University to study Interior Design. Once I completed my degree, I went on to Project Management at the Chang School. I am very proud of the education that I have received and as a result, I feel that my work reflects my passion.

Through the years, I have been fortunate enough to work with Brian Gluckstein during the launch of Hudson’s Bay Home line (Toronto),  Andrea Kantelberg, a condo commercial designer based in Toronto, Robin Fraser, a restaurant designer, as well as an internship with ALSOP Architects under Will Alsop.

I consider myself very fortunate to have been able to work with these wonderful and creative minds, especially since they were just beginning to emerge as the frontrunners in their fields during my time with them.

Most recently, my focus has been on cabinetry, specifically kitchen and bathroom, but my favorite thing to design and work on is closet organization. Maximum efficiency is a draw for me.
